diff --git a/CMakeLists.txt b/CMakeLists.txt index e5038bbd34f72c60f453c44fce51464c22ad348d..85234f8fdfcd1b97782f2d495da595abca19a727 100755 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-2,20 +2,30 @@ cmake_minimum_required(VERSION 2.8) project (dap_chain_net_srv_app) set(DAP_CHAIN_NET_SRV_APP_SRCS - dap_chain_net_srv_app.c + dap_chain_net_srv_app.c ) set(DAP_CHAIN_NET_SRV_APP_HEADERS dap_chain_net_srv_app.h ) -add_library(${PROJECT_NAME} STATIC ${DAP_CHAIN_NET_SRV_APP_SRCS} ${DAP_CHAIN_NET_SRV_APP_HEADERS}) +if(WIN32) + include_directories(../libdap/src/win32/) + include_directories(../3rdparty/libmemcached/) + include_directories(../3rdparty/libmemcached/win32/) + include_directories(../3rdparty/wepoll/include/) + include_directories(../3rdparty/uthash/src/) + include_directories(../3rdparty/libjson-c/) + include_directories(../3rdparty/libmagic/src/) + include_directories(../3rdparty/curl/include/) + include_directories(../3rdparty/libsqlite3/) +endif() +add_library(${PROJECT_NAME} STATIC ${DAP_CHAIN_NET_SRV_APP_SRCS} ${DAP_CHAIN_NET_SRV_APP_HEADERS}) -target_link_libraries(dap_chain_net_srv_app dap_core dap_crypto dap_chain dap_chain_crypto dap_chain_net dap_chain_net_srv ) +target_link_libraries(dap_chain_net_srv_app dap_core dap_crypto dap_chain dap_chain_crypto dap_chain_net dap_chain_net_srv) target_include_directories(dap_chain_net_srv_app INTERFACE .) - set(${PROJECT_NAME}_DEFINITIONS CACHE INTERNAL "${PROJECT_NAME}: Definitions" FORCE) set(${PROJECT_NAME}_INCLUDE_DIRS ${PROJECT_SOURCE_DIR} CACHE INTERNAL "${PROJECT_NAME}: Include Directories" FORCE)